top of page

Why Learning Coding & AI Is Important for Kids — Exploring Real Coding and AI Benefits


Learning coding and AI from a young age is no longer just an optional skill. It has become a crucial foundation for developing creativity, problem-solving, and logical thinking. Children exposed to coding and AI early can explore technology in a way that sharpens their minds while encouraging curiosity. They don’t just learn to program; they learn to think critically, experiment confidently, and approach challenges with innovative solutions.


The coding and AI benefits for kids extend beyond the screen. For instance, coding improves mathematical reasoning, enhances concentration, and boosts decision-making skills. Meanwhile, AI introduces children to real-world applications like chatbots, smart games, and simple robotics. This combination prepares them for a future where technology and creativity intersect.


In this guide, you’ll explore how coding and AI education have evolved over the years and how children of different ages can grasp core concepts. You’ll also find practical tools, project ideas, and examples that make learning engaging and effective. Additionally, we will cover challenges parents and teachers may face and offer strategies to overcome them.


By the end, you’ll understand why these skills matter today and how to introduce them effectively, ensuring your child gains meaningful experience. Let’s dive into the journey of coding and AI for kids, starting with its broader significance.


Why Coding and AI Benefits Matter for Kids — The Big Picture


Learning coding and AI from an early age does more than teach children how to write programs. It strengthens computational thinking, helping kids break down complex problems into manageable steps. This skill carries over to daily life, improving decision-making, planning, and logical reasoning. Moreover, exposure to coding encourages creativity, as children design games, apps, or interactive stories that reflect their ideas. Simultaneously, AI projects introduce problem-solving in dynamic, real-world contexts, like programming a simple chatbot or training an AI to recognise images.


The importance of coding for kids goes beyond technical skills. Studies show that children who engage in coding demonstrate better performance in math and science. In fact, research from Code.org indicates that 67% of students feel more confident solving problems after learning coding fundamentals. Additionally, coding and AI help improve collaboration and communication skills. For example, when children work together on robotics or coding projects, they learn to share ideas, test solutions, and refine strategies.


Here are some key coding and AI benefits for kids:

  • Logical reasoning: Breaking tasks into steps and understanding cause-and-effect relationships.

  • Creativity: Designing games, animations, or AI experiments that reflect personal ideas.

  • Digital literacy: Familiarity with technology prepares children for a tech-driven world.

  • Future preparedness: Early coding skills lay the groundwork for careers in STEM and AI.

Consider the example of a 10-year-old who created a simple game using Scratch. Through this project, the child learned sequencing, conditional logic, and problem-solving, while also enjoying a sense of accomplishment.

Ultimately, understanding the coding and AI benefits for kids highlights why these skills are vital today. Next, we will explore how coding and AI education have evolved to become accessible and engaging for children.


A Brief Evolution of Coding & AI Education for Kids


The history of coding education for children dates back to the 1960s, when languages like LOGO introduced turtle graphics to teach logic and problem-solving. Shortly after, BASIC became a common beginner-friendly language, allowing kids to experiment with simple programs on home computers. These early tools focused heavily on syntax, requiring precise commands and careful typing.


Over the years, teaching methods shifted toward more engaging, project-based approaches. Platforms like Scratch and Code.org made coding visual and playful, letting kids create games, animations, and interactive stories without worrying about complex syntax. Similarly, hardware tools like micro: bit and LEGO Robotics introduced hands-on learning, blending coding with real-world problem-solving.


The rise of AI education for kids adds a new dimension. Platforms such as Cognimates, Teachable Machine, and AI4Kids let children experiment with machine learning concepts, image recognition, and simple AI models. These tools encourage creativity while introducing computational thinking and logic in accessible ways.


Key milestones in the evolution of coding and AI education for kids:

  • 1960s–70s: LOGO, early BASIC programs

  • 2000s: Scratch, Code.org launches

  • 2010s: micro: bit, LEGO Robotics

  • 2020s: Kid-friendly AI platforms like Cognimates

This evolution highlights how coding and AI education have grown from rigid syntax learning to playful, hands-on experiences. Next, we will explore the core concepts kids should learn at different ages.


Core Concepts Kids Should Learn (Age-Graded)


Colorful abacus with numbered pegs and beads in red, blue, yellow, green. Math equations visible, set against a plain white background.

Understanding coding basics for kids and introducing AI concepts gradually can make learning fun and effective. Children of different ages have unique learning needs, and tailoring projects to their developmental stage ensures engagement and skill-building.


Age 5–8: Foundations Through Play


At this stage, kids benefit most from block coding, sequencing, and pattern recognition. Visual programming platforms like Scratch Jr. or Kodable allow children to drag and drop code blocks, helping them understand cause-and-effect relationships. Simple AI concepts can be introduced through games, such as recognising objects or predicting outcomes. For example, a child might create a game where a character reacts to user input, teaching logic without overwhelming syntax. These activities enhance problem-solving, creativity, and digital familiarity.


Age 8–12: Exploring Python and Simple AI


Children in this age group can handle beginner Python, loops, conditionals, and simple machine learning logic. Platforms like Tynker, Code.org, and AI4Kids provide interactive exercises. Kids can experiment with small AI projects, such as creating an image recognition game or a chatbot that answers basic questions. For instance, one 10-year-old successfully programmed a quiz chatbot using Python, learning how to structure logic, handle inputs, and debug errors. These projects reinforce computational thinking while maintaining a sense of accomplishment.


Age 12+: Intermediate Coding and Ethical AI


At this level, children can tackle intermediate coding projects and basic AI algorithms. They can experiment with small-scale projects that include data input, decision-making, and predictive outcomes. Additionally, introducing ethics in AI helps them understand responsible technology use. Platforms like micro: bit or beginner TensorFlow models let children create interactive games, robotics, or AI experiments. These projects deepen problem-solving skills, enhance logical reasoning, and encourage innovative thinking.


Quick Summary Table (Visual Suggestion):


Age

Key Concepts

Example Project

5–8

Block coding, sequencing, pattern recognition

Simple drag-and-drop game

8–12

Python basics, loops, conditionals, simple AI

Quiz chatbot, image recognition game

12+

Intermediate coding, AI algorithms, ethics

AI-powered robot, predictive game


Practical Applications of Coding & AI for Kids


Exploring real-world coding projects for kids makes learning engaging and meaningful. When children apply coding and AI to practical tasks, they develop problem-solving, logical thinking, and creativity simultaneously. Projects also boost confidence, as kids see their ideas come to life.


One popular application is game development. Using platforms like Scratch or Tynker, children can design simple games with characters, scoring, and levels. For example:

  1. Choose a theme: Pick a favourite story or animal.

  2. Design characters: Drag and drop sprites and backgrounds.

  3. Add interactions: Use blocks to create movement, scoring, and challenges.

  4.  By completing this project, children practice sequencing, loops, and debugging while creating something fun to share.


Simple robotics is another practical application. Using LEGO Robotics or micro: bit kits, kids can program small robots to navigate mazes, respond to light, or follow paths. Step-by-step projects include:

  • Assemble the robot.

  • Write basic code to control movement.

  • Test and adjust the robot’s behaviour.

  •  This approach encourages teamwork, planning, and logical reasoning.


AI-based projects expand creativity even further. For instance, AI art generators or chatbots let children experiment with machine learning concepts:

  • Input images or text for the AI to process.

  • Adjust parameters to modify output.

  • Share or refine the final creation.

  •  These projects show children the connection between algorithms and creative outputs.


By participating in AI projects for children, kids not only learn technical skills but also enhance collaboration, critical thinking, and problem-solving. Visuals like screenshots or diagrams of these projects can make the learning process more tangible and inspiring.


Hands-on projects demonstrate how coding and AI are not just abstract concepts but tools for creativity and learning. Next, we’ll explore the best tools and platforms to support kids in coding and AI education.


Top Tools and Platforms for Learning Coding & AI


A person soldering a circuit board under warm lamp light, focused expression, with tools and a red-capped bottle on the wooden desk.

Choosing the right coding tools for kids and AI learning platforms for children can make a huge difference in engagement and skill development. Kid-friendly tools simplify complex concepts and make learning interactive.


Popular coding tools for kids include:

  • Scratch: Ideal for ages 5–12, Scratch uses visual blocks to teach sequencing and logic. Pros: highly interactive and beginner-friendly. Cons: limited text-based coding experience.

  • Code.org: Ages 6+, offers guided tutorials and coding challenges. Pros: structured lessons; Cons: may feel rigid for creative projects.

  • Tynker: Ages 7+, supports block and Python coding. Pros: gamified learning; Cons: premium content requires a subscription.

  • micro:bit: Ages 8+, integrates coding with physical devices. Pros: hands-on robotics experience; Cons: hardware required.

  • LEGO Robotics: Ages 8+, perfect for building and programming robots. Pros: highly engaging; Cons: cost of kits.


Beginner AI tools for children include:

  • Cognimates: Ages 8+, allows kids to train AI models for games and robotics. Pros: introduces machine learning; Cons: requires some guidance.

  • Google Teachable Machine: Ages 10+, simple drag-and-drop AI model training. Pros: visual and easy to use; Cons: limited project complexity.

  • AI4Kids: Ages 10+, offers interactive AI experiments. Pros: beginner-friendly AI exposure; Cons: advanced concepts are limited.


A visual comparison chart can help parents and educators quickly see age recommendations, features, and pros/cons side by side.


By using these tools, children gain hands-on experience while enjoying interactive learning. Next, we’ll look at research-backed statistics and measurable benefits of coding and AI education for kids.


Statistics & Research-Backed Benefits of Learning Coding & AI


The coding and AI benefits statistics clearly show why introducing children to these skills early matters. Studies indicate that kids who engage in coding improve their problem-solving abilities, logical reasoning, and overall STEM interest. For example, research by Code.org reports that 67% of students feel more confident solving problems after learning coding basics. Additionally, children develop digital literacy, learning to navigate technology safely and creatively.


Global adoption of coding curricula also highlights the growing importance of these skills. According to UNESCO, over 80 countries have integrated coding into primary and secondary education. In the United States, more than 75% of schools provide some form of computer science or coding lessons, while in Europe, initiatives like Scratch and micro: bit programs are widely used. These statistics demonstrate that coding is not only a technical skill but also a key educational tool.


Other measurable benefits of coding and AI for children include:

  • Improved math performance: Coding exercises strengthen logical thinking and numerical skills.

  • Enhanced creativity: Students designing games or AI projects explore new ideas and innovative solutions.

  • Collaboration skills: Group projects in coding and robotics teach teamwork and communication.

  • Future readiness: Early coding experience correlates with interest in STEM careers.


Visual representations, such as bar charts or graphs showing improvement in problem-solving, STEM interest, and digital literacy, can further illustrate these benefits.


These statistics underscore the tangible impact of coding and AI on children’s cognitive and creative development. Next, we’ll discuss common challenges parents and educators face when introducing kids to coding and AI.


Challenges Parents and Educators Face


Introducing coding and AI to children comes with its share of obstacles. One of the main challenges of teaching coding to kids is limited time. Many parents and teachers struggle to fit coding lessons into busy schedules. Additionally, some educators lack proper training, making it difficult to guide children effectively. Screen-time concerns also arise, as too much digital exposure can be counterproductive for young learners.


Despite these barriers, practical solutions can make learning coding and AI enjoyable and effective. Project-based learning encourages children to apply concepts in creative ways, keeping them engaged while reinforcing skills. Short, interactive sessions work better than long, continuous lessons, allowing kids to focus without feeling overwhelmed. Choosing age-appropriate tools like Scratch, Tynker, or micro: bit ensures children can experiment safely and confidently.


Here are some quick strategies to overcome AI learning difficulties for children:

  • Break lessons into 20–30 minute sessions.

  • Combine screen activities with hands-on projects like robotics kits.

  • Encourage collaboration through group projects or coding clubs.

  • Use visual learning platforms to simplify complex concepts.


A listicle-style infographic can highlight these challenges and solutions visually, making it easier for parents and educators to implement them.


By addressing these challenges thoughtfully, coding and AI education can become a positive and manageable experience for every child. Next, we’ll explore emerging trends and the future of coding and AI for kids.


Emerging Trends & The Future of Coding & AI for Kids


The future of coding education is evolving rapidly, driven by AI-powered learning apps and interactive platforms. These tools adapt lessons to each child’s pace, making learning personalised and engaging. Gamified learning has also become a key trend, turning coding exercises into challenges, competitions, and rewards, which keeps children motivated while teaching essential skills.


Another important trend is ethical AI education. As children learn to build AI models, understanding responsible and fair use of technology becomes crucial. Introducing ethics alongside technical skills helps kids develop awareness about bias, privacy, and societal impact. Platforms like Cognimates and Teachable Machine now include modules that teach these concepts in simple, age-appropriate ways.


Looking ahead, AI literacy will become essential in future workplaces. Children who understand AI principles and coding logic will be better equipped for careers in technology, science, healthcare, and creative industries. Early exposure also fosters problem-solving, innovation, and adaptability, skills highly valued in any field.


Key trends shaping the future of coding and AI for children:

  • Personalised, AI-driven learning apps

  • Gamified coding challenges and interactive projects

  • Ethical AI education integrated into curricula

  • Hands-on, project-based AI experiments.


Visuals like futuristic illustrations of AI-powered classrooms or screenshots of gamified platforms can highlight these trends effectively.


Understanding these emerging trends helps parents and educators prepare children for a tech-driven world. Next, we’ll answer common questions about coding and AI for kids in the FAQ section.


FAQs 


1. At what age should children start learning coding?


 Children can begin as early as five with block-based platforms like Scratch Jr. Early exposure develops logical thinking and problem-solving skills gradually.


2. Is AI too complex for kids to understand?


 Not at all. Beginner-friendly AI tools like Teachable Machine or Cognimates introduce simple concepts visually. Kids can train models and experiment safely while learning foundational logic.


3. What are the easiest coding languages for kids?


Block-based languages like Scratch or Tynker work best for ages 5–12. Older children can explore beginner Python, which balances simplicity with real-world programming skills.


4. How can parents encourage coding and AI learning at home?


 Parents can:

  • Set aside short, interactive learning sessions

  • Provide hands-on projects like robotics kits.

  • Encourage collaborative projects with friends or siblings.

  • Celebrate achievements to keep motivation high.

5. Do coding skills guarantee future career success?


Coding builds critical thinking and problem-solving, but it does not guarantee a career. However, early coding exposure increases interest in STEM and prepares kids for a tech-driven future.


These coding and AI benefits FAQs help clarify common concerns and provide practical guidance for parents and educators. Next, we’ll wrap up with a summary and actionable steps for introducing kids to coding and AI.


Conclusion


The coding and AI benefits for kids go far beyond technical skills. Children develop problem-solving abilities, boost creativity, and improve digital literacy, all while preparing for a technology-driven future. Starting early allows kids to build confidence and enjoy gradual learning at their own pace.


Using age-appropriate tools like Scratch, Tynker, micro: bit, and beginner AI platforms ensures lessons remain engaging and effective. Project-based activities reinforce concepts while making learning fun.


Parents and educators can take action today by:

  • Exploring recommended coding projects and AI experiments

  • Leveraging downloadable guides and starter kits

  • Encouraging collaboration and hands-on experimentation


By integrating these strategies, children gain meaningful experience while enjoying the learning process. Start now to unlock the full potential of coding and AI education for your child.


Next, consider exploring our curated list of tools and resources to kickstart hands-on projects and interactive AI experiences.

Comments


bottom of page